What Usually Causes Drafty Windows
A draft usually starts as a small problem, then becomes obvious during a cold snap or a windy day.
In Great Falls, VA, even a modest leak can stand out in a tall room, a sunroom, or a formal space with wide glass areas.
Most drafts trace back to worn sealing materials, window alignment issues, or frame deterioration rather than the glass itself.
Sometimes the problem is not a dramatic failure at all, but a combination of small gaps that add up.

If moisture appears between panes, that usually points to a failed insulated glass seal, which is a different issue from surface condensation.
Drafts can show up as noise intrusion too, especially on homes near busy roads or wooded lots where wind and sound travel in different ways.
On exposed sites, draft control and sound reduction often go hand in hand.
Choosing The Right Fix For Your Home
Not every draft means the window needs to be replaced.
If the issue is minor, a targeted repair may be enough.
When the window is older, warped, or repeatedly failing, replacement becomes the better long-term choice.

If you are weighing repair against replacement, a few points usually settle it.
- Choose repair for small, localized issues
- Choose replacement when the failure is repeated or widespread
- Choose replacement when comfort, noise, and efficiency are all slipping
- Choose replacement when you want a long-term reset instead of a short patch
